Will the 2024 presidential debate be a clash of personalities or a battle of policies? As we gear up for this high-stakes showdown, we dissect the personas and potential strategies of Joe Biden and Donald Trump. With CNN's moderators possibly leaning left and the chance of Trump being provoked, the dynamics promise to be intense.
